1 API Gateway Pattern API Gateway is like a traffic cop in the world of computer services which handles the traffic over site It decides where information should go checks if you re allowed to send or get information keeps track of what s happening and can change the information s format if needed

Design patterns for microservices Azure Architecture Center, Azure Architecture Center Design patterns for microservices Azure Services The goal of microservices is to increase the velo of application releases by decomposing the application into small autonomous services that can be deployed independently A microservices architecture also brings some challenges
